Proficient Evisceration: Mastering the Gutting Knife

When dealing with field dressing, a sharp and reliable gutting knife is your primary tool. Choosing the suitable blade isn't just about preference; it directly impacts your efficiency and cleanliness. A good gutting knife should be long-bladed, with a balanced spine for maneuvering around tissue with ease. The handle needs to be comfortable for extended use, as you'll be making numerous swift cuts. Training with the knife is crucial before embarking on a real-world scenario.

  • Excelling in the art of evisceration requires a methodical approach, starting with sharp cuts to open the abdominal cavity.
  • Carefully remove the entrails, avoiding any contact with the remains, which could contaminate the meat.
  • Thoroughly clean the area after gutting to prevent bacterial growth and ensure a safe and edible end product.

Remember, a well-gutted animal is essential for both safety and taste.
